Description Justin Copeland 2003-01-22 04:03:05 UTC
I guess you want to know just exactly what whiteBOX is? Well, whiteBOX is a
configuration tool for the blackbox window manager. It features a menu editor, a
style editor, a background tool, and a keybinding tool.

whiteBOX features a modular architecture (using plugins) so it is easy to expand
on (nudge nudge developers :)). Of course, this also means it is easy for you to
tailor whiteBOX to suit your needs. whiteBOX can be easily integrated into
blackbox (via the menu) and into bbkeys (via a patch - see downloads section),
so that it just becomes part of the furniture of blackbox.

Also, for all you blackbox derivative fans (i.e: fluxbox, openbox, etc), its
likely blackbox will work for you too.

Comment 3 Matt Keadle 2003-06-19 19:11:19 UTC
builds and installs clean, but there seems to be two pixmaps used for buttons that are missing from the archive. i'll go digging in older archives to see if they ever existed and commit when/if i find them.
Comment 4 Matt Keadle 2003-06-20 08:03:49 UTC
found the pixmaps in the rpm for 4.1. tbz2'd them up and add a secondary SRC_URI so they'll get pulled in. commited. thanks for the submission.
